About [4-[3-[2-(3-chlorophenyl)ethyl-(2,5-dichlorophenyl)sulfonylamino]-2,5-dioxopyrrolidin-1-yl]phenyl] acetate

[4-[3-[2-(3-chlorophenyl)ethyl-(2,5-dichlorophenyl)sulfonylamino]-2,5-dioxopyrrolidin-1-yl]phenyl] acetate (PubChem CID 23886797) has the molecular formula C26H21Cl3N2O6S and a molecular weight of 595.89 g/mol. Its IUPAC name is [4-[3-[2-(3-chlorophenyl)ethyl-(2,5-dichlorophenyl)sulfonylamino]-2,5-dioxopyrrolidin-1-yl]phenyl] acetate.
